摘要
激光冲击板料变形是利用高能脉冲激光和材料相互作用诱导的高幅冲击波的力效应使板料产生塑性变形的新技术。利用ABAQUS软件对激光冲击下板料的变形过程进行了数值模拟,比较了不同激光参数对板料变形量的影响,并在激光单点冲击成形的基础上探讨了激光多点冲击成形。
The sheet metal deforming induced by laser shock peening is a new technique realized by laser induced shock wave on the surface of sheet metal. Numerical simulation of sheet metal forming process was done with the ABAQUS software. Some influenced factors to the results of deforming contour and magnitude were discussed. And sheet metal forming caused by multi-laser-shocking investigated on the bases of single-laser-shock forming.
